全面解析V2Ray重放机制与安全防护

什么是V2Ray重放?

V2Ray重放指的是通过对已经存在的网络请求进行重放,可能会导致信息泄露、数据篡改或服务被攻击的一种网络安全问题。V2Ray作为一种强大的网络代理工具,在使用过程中如何防范重放攻击是我们必须重视的议题。

V2Ray重放的原理

重放攻击通常是指攻击者捕获并重发有效的数据包。以下是重放攻击的基本原理:

  • 数据包捕获:攻击者通过监听网络流量获取合法的请求数据。
  • 数据包重放:攻击者将捕获的数据包再次发送到目标服务器,试图伪装成合法用户。
  • 执行操作:如果目标服务器没有有效的身份验证机制,可能会执行重放的请求,从而导致信息泄露或篡改。

V2Ray重放攻击的常见形式

  1. HTTP重放:在HTTP协议下,攻击者可以重放HTTP请求,造成数据误操作。
  2. WebSocket重放:利用WebSocket持久连接特性进行重放,可能会导致长连接数据被误用。
  3. TCP重放:通过对TCP数据包进行重放,攻击者可以干扰正常的连接状态。

如何防止V2Ray重放攻击?

为有效防止重放攻击,建议采取以下措施:

  • 使用HTTPS:通过SSL/TLS加密传输的数据包,能有效防止数据被窃取和重放。
  • 请求唯一标识:为每个请求生成一个唯一标识符,如时间戳或随机数,以确保每个请求的唯一性。
  • 身份验证机制:实施强有力的身份验证机制,如OAuth 2.0,以防止未授权访问。
  • 请求签名:对请求进行签名,确保请求数据在传输过程中未被篡改。

V2Ray重放攻击的检测

检测V2Ray重放攻击可以通过以下方式进行:

  • 监控流量:使用流量监控工具检测异常流量或重复请求。
  • 日志分析:定期分析服务器日志,查找重复请求或异常行为。
  • 引入安全工具:部署Web应用防火墙(WAF)来防范已知攻击。

V2Ray重放的实际案例

在过去的网络安全事件中,很多公司因未能有效防范重放攻击而受到损失。例如,某在线支付平台因数据未加密,导致用户的支付信息被攻击者重放,从而造成经济损失。

V2Ray重放相关工具与插件

使用V2Ray时,可以利用以下工具与插件来增强安全性:

  • V2Ray插件:利用特定插件增强加密与身份验证。
  • 安全监控工具:如Snort、Suricata等,实时监控流量。
  • 数据包捕获工具:如Wireshark,进行流量分析与攻击检测。

常见问题解答 (FAQ)

Q1: V2Ray重放攻击会造成哪些后果?

A1: 重放攻击可能导致数据泄露、账户盗用、非法交易等安全隐患。

Q2: 如何检测到重放攻击?

A2: 通过流量监控、日志分析和引入安全工具可以有效检测到重放攻击。

Q3: 如何增强V2Ray的安全性?

A3: 采用HTTPS加密、实施身份验证机制、使用唯一请求标识等方法均可增强V2Ray的安全性。

Q4: V2Ray的安全设置中有什么推荐的实践?

A4: 定期更新软件、监控流量、实施最小权限原则等都是推荐的安全实践。

Q5: V2Ray重放攻击是否完全可防范?

A5: 虽然没有绝对安全的方法,但通过加强网络安全措施可以大大降低重放攻击的风险。

结语

V2Ray重放问题虽然技术性强,但在网络安全中具有重要意义。通过上述的防范措施与技术手段,可以在很大程度上降低重放攻击的风险,保护用户信息安全。希望大家能认真对待,提升自己的网络安全意识。

正文完